As the name suggests tiered link building functions like the pyramid structure: each layer is a support for the next. A link from Forbes that promotes your website is the first tier link. The Tier two links on Tumblr would promote it. Tier 2 links are usually non-follow, so they don't transfer link equity to the sites that they link to. They assist in promoting and draw attention to Tier 2 websites.
Local directories
Local directories are a powerful way to boost your SEO, but it is essential to choose the right ones. Directory sites with greater domain authority will pass more search engine juice to the search engines and are more visible in organic searches. The quality of your listing will also be judged by the number of backlinks that point to your site.
Customers want consistent information about companies, so it's vital to keep your listings up-to-date. There are solutions that enable local businesses to keep their listings across several sites. These tools can save businesses time as well as money by automatizing the update process. They can also assist with the maintenance and updating of reviews and ratings.
